Commit 1196fa88 authored by Timothy J. Baek's avatar Timothy J. Baek
Browse files

fix: openai model support

parent 044ee2a7
...@@ -85,6 +85,7 @@ ...@@ -85,6 +85,7 @@
}; };
const sendPromptOllama = async (model, userPrompt, parentId) => { const sendPromptOllama = async (model, userPrompt, parentId) => {
console.log('sendPromptOllama');
let responseMessageId = uuidv4(); let responseMessageId = uuidv4();
let responseMessage = { let responseMessage = {
...@@ -214,7 +215,7 @@ ...@@ -214,7 +215,7 @@
}; };
const sendPromptOpenAI = async (model, userPrompt, parentId) => { const sendPromptOpenAI = async (model, userPrompt, parentId) => {
if (settings.OPENAI_API_KEY) { if ($settings.OPENAI_API_KEY) {
if (models) { if (models) {
let responseMessageId = uuidv4(); let responseMessageId = uuidv4();
...@@ -242,7 +243,7 @@ ...@@ -242,7 +243,7 @@
method: 'POST', method: 'POST',
headers: { headers: {
'Content-Type': 'application/json', 'Content-Type': 'application/json',
Authorization: `Bearer ${settings.OPENAI_API_KEY}` Authorization: `Bearer ${$settings.OPENAI_API_KEY}`
}, },
body: JSON.stringify({ body: JSON.stringify({
model: model, model: model,
...@@ -251,7 +252,7 @@ ...@@ -251,7 +252,7 @@
$settings.system $settings.system
? { ? {
role: 'system', role: 'system',
content: settings.system content: $settings.system
} }
: undefined, : undefined,
...messages ...messages
......
...@@ -251,7 +251,7 @@ ...@@ -251,7 +251,7 @@
}; };
const sendPromptOpenAI = async (model, userPrompt, parentId) => { const sendPromptOpenAI = async (model, userPrompt, parentId) => {
if (settings.OPENAI_API_KEY) { if ($settings.OPENAI_API_KEY) {
if (models) { if (models) {
let responseMessageId = uuidv4(); let responseMessageId = uuidv4();
...@@ -279,7 +279,7 @@ ...@@ -279,7 +279,7 @@
method: 'POST', method: 'POST',
headers: { headers: {
'Content-Type': 'application/json', 'Content-Type': 'application/json',
Authorization: `Bearer ${settings.OPENAI_API_KEY}` Authorization: `Bearer ${$settings.OPENAI_API_KEY}`
}, },
body: JSON.stringify({ body: JSON.stringify({
model: model, model: model,
...@@ -288,7 +288,7 @@ ...@@ -288,7 +288,7 @@
$settings.system $settings.system
? { ? {
role: 'system', role: 'system',
content: settings.system content: $settings.system
} }
: undefined, : undefined,
...messages ...messages
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ment